Sorry if this has been discussed before but we here in the colonies need a bit of advice.

The DLOC here in New South Wales has acquired a Lanchester Leda for restoration. it is a club project and so far some wonderful and skilled volunteers have been giving up their Thursdays preparing the car for painting.

A lot of work has been done and some panels which have what we think is the original paint colour have been found but the concern is that the paint would have faded with time and we would like to get the right colour for the car. If we get a computer match it would be a match for the old panels and may not be accurate for when the car was new.

The car was, it would seem, painted a dark green originally, not a metallic colour, just dark green.

Does anyone have nay colour details of what the Leda range could have been painted from the factory?

I had thought that perhaps the colour range was shared with the Conquest but I have been told otherwise.
